You can put this solution on YOUR website! 2x + 8y = -16 [Re-write in the slope-intercept form: y = mx+b]
2x + 8y = -16 [solve for y]
2x-2x+8y=-2x-16
8y=-2x-16
8y/8=-2x/8 - 16/8
y=-2/8x - 16/8
y = -1/4x - 2
